The CZY-FS07 uses a PC Plastic (Polycarbonate) body with a zinc alloy meltable element.
| Component | Material |
|---|---|
| Fuse Body | PC Plastic (Polycarbonate) |
| Meltable Element | Zinc Alloy |
The rated current is marked on the fuse body for easy identification.
| Item | Specification |
|---|---|
| Product Type | Maxi Blade Fuse |
| Model | CZY-FS07 |
| Body Material | PC Plastic (Polycarbonate) |
| Fuse Element Material | Zinc Alloy |
| Operating Voltage | 32V DC |
| Current Range | 20A-100A |
| Standard | QC/T420-2004 |
| Application | Automotive DC Circuit Protection |

The CZY-FS07 Maxi Blade Fuse features a larger automotive fuse structure designed for high-current applications.
| Dimension | Value |
|---|---|
| Length | 29.5 mm |
| Height | 21.8 mm |
| Width | 8.9 mm |
| Terminal Height | 12.7 mm |
| Terminal Thickness | 0.8 mm |

Automotive blade fuses are available in different sizes, including Micro, Mini, Standard and Maxi formats.
Maxi blade fuses are designed for higher current applications compared with smaller blade fuse types.
The replacement fuse should match the original circuit requirements.
Choosing the correct current rating helps maintain proper circuit protection.
The CZY-FS07 is designed for automotive applications below 32V.
